The ingredients needed to make Mint cumin raita:
  1. Take 1 cup yoghurt
  2. Prepare 3/4 tsp cumin powder
  3. Make ready 5-6 mint leaves, finely chopped
  4. Make ready 1 green chilli, minced finely
  5. Make ready to taste Salt

Instructions to make Mint cumin raita:
  1. Slight muddle the mint leaves and chili till it becomes a little pasty.
  2. Add the remaining ingredients and whisk till smooth.
  3. Leave in the fridge for as long as possible for the flavors to mingle.
  4. Serve cold with biriyanis or parathas.
